126106023 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 168141368. Its totient is φ = 84070680.

The previous prime is 126106009. The next prime is 126106039. The reversal of 126106023 is 320601621.

It is a happy number.

It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 126106023 - 213 = 126097831 is a prime.

It is a Duffinian number.

It is a congruent number.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(126106063)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 21017668 + ... + 21017673.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(42035342).

Almost surely, 2126106023 is an apocalyptic number.

126106023 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(42035345).

126106023 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

126106023 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The sum of its prime factors is 42035344.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 432, while the sum is 21.

The square root of 126106023 is about 11229.6938070457. The cubic root of 126106023 is about 501.4703691241.

Adding to 126106023 its reverse (320601621), we get a palindrome (446707644).
